Pezhere, your request sounds like a scam for these reasons:

1. The beer retails at the LCBO annually for under $150.
2. The beer doesn't improve in the bottle.
3. Each release is somewhat comparable (it's blended to maintain a somewhat consistent profile).
3. The $150 price point is extremely rare in beer. It is already off putting for many (is it as good as Soctch/Port/Sherry at the same price?)
4. Nobody sells stuff on here. Ever. Especially not for half a grand.
5. $500 could but you 2-3 beer runs to the States and hundreds of bottles of high quality beer.
6. Premier Gourmet sells most of its rare bottles for under $50.
